Following carpal tunnel decompression in my left hand I attended the hand therapy clinic for rehabilitation.

I was unsure as to what would happen at this appointment and how it would help.

On meeting with Andrew I felt reassured and encouraged to complete my treatment plan and found it to be very beneficial to my recovery.
